Missed-payment timeline
| Timeline | What happens |
|---|---|
| Day 1 | Penalty interest accrues; SMS notification sent |
| Day 3–7 | DebiCheck retry attempt |
| Day 30+ | Credit-bureau listing recorded |
| Day 60+ | Handover to collections |
| Day 90+ | Potential legal action |

Best practices for repayment
- Align DebiCheck with payday where possible
- Pay early when you can — daily interest makes early settlement cheaper
- Call support before the due date if hardship is likely
- Keep payment proof for three years

Early settlement
Under NCA Section 125, settle early without prepayment penalty — capital plus accrued interest, unpaid fees and pro-rated insurance. Use cabinet bank details and your loan reference.

FAQ — How to repay
Can I settle my CrediWise loan early? Yes — no penalty under NCA Section 125; interest only for days outstanding.
What happens if my DebiCheck fails? Retry within days; penalty interest starts from the first failed collection.
How do I request an extension? Contact support before the due date — extensions are discretionary, never automatic.
